      Big-science facilities are often associated with fundamental research. You might picture scientists hunting for elementary particles, or searching to understand the nature of dark matter.

      But some facilities – especially high-energy physics labs – are also turning their focus to practical applications of quantum physics. The opportunities for science, industry and society are vast.

      That’s the theme of a new special issue of Physics World called “Big Science, Quantum Advantage”. Free-to-access now, the issue profiles some of the latest developments in Europe, the US and China.
